Getting There

  • Public Bus

    From any major bus terminal in Lagos, such as the Yaba Bus Terminal, take a bus heading towards Akoka. Make sure to ask the conductor for the bus that goes to Akoka or the University of Lagos area. Upon reaching Akoka, ask the driver to drop you off at Sapara Road. Once you get off, walk along Sapara Road towards the direction of the Natural History Museum. The museum is located at GC92+V36, Sapara Rd.

  • Bicycle

    If you prefer to cycle, you can rent a bicycle from a local vendor. Start from a central location in Lagos, such as the National Museum. Head towards Ikorodu Road, then take a left turn at the intersection leading to Sapara Road. Continue straight on Sapara Road until you reach the Natural History Museum, located on the left side at GC92+V36.

  • Walking

    If you're nearby, for instance, at the University of Lagos, you can walk to the Natural History Museum. Exit the university campus and head towards the main road. Walk straight down to Sapara Road. The museum is located at GC92+V36 on Sapara Road, which is a short walk from the university.

  • Taxi or Ride-Hailing Service

    You can use a local taxi or a ride-hailing app like Bolt or Uber. Simply input 'Natural History Museum, GC92+V36, Sapara Rd, Akoka, Lagos' as your destination. The driver will take you directly to the museum. Make sure to confirm the address with the driver before starting your journey.

Discover more about Natural History Museum

Nestled in the heart of Lagos, the Natural History Museum is a treasure trove for anyone interested in the world's natural wonders. This captivating museum features an extensive collection of exhibits that showcase the incredible diversity of life on Earth, including fascinating displays of fossils, minerals, and specimens from various ecosystems. From prehistoric creatures to the vibrant flora and fauna of Nigeria, visitors will embark on a journey through time and nature, making it an enriching experience for tourists of all ages. The museum's engaging layout not only highlights the beauty of our planet but also educates visitors about conservation and the importance of protecting our environment. Open throughout the week from 9 AM to 4 PM, the museum encourages visitors to dedicate a few hours to fully appreciate its offerings. Families will find the museum particularly welcoming, with interactive displays that captivate children's imaginations and stimulate their curiosity about the natural world. The knowledgeable staff is also on hand to provide insights and answer questions, enhancing the overall experience. Additionally, the museum frequently hosts special exhibitions and events that showcase local heritage and biodiversity, adding to the dynamic atmosphere.
